Keyence business model

The Keyence Corporation is a Japanese company founded in 1974. Its headquarters is located in Osaka, Japan. The company operates in the field of industrial automation and specializes in the development and production of sensors, measuring devices, machine vision systems, and industrial robots. Keyence's business model is based on innovative solutions aimed at increasing productivity and efficiency in the manufacturing industry. The company offers a wide range of products that allow for the optimization and automation of manufacturing processes, resulting in higher production speed and better quality end products. Keyence has several business divisions, including automation and safety, measurement and inspection, barcode scanners and code reading systems, as well as laser marking systems. In the automation and safety division, Keyence offers industrial robots, safety sensors, and optical detection systems for the automation of fabrication processes. The measurement and inspection division includes highly precise measuring devices and inspection systems for quality assurance in manufacturing processes. Keyence's barcode scanners and code reading systems are used in various industries, such as logistics, commerce, and the pharmaceutical industry. These systems enable quick and efficient identification of products and components. Keyence also offers a range of laser marking systems. These systems allow for the fast and precise marking of products with labels or barcodes. Keyence's laser marking systems are used in various industries, such as the automotive industry and electronics manufacturing. Keyence products are known for their high quality and reliability. The company is renowned for its high level of innovation and its ability to develop solutions tailored to the specific needs of its customers. Keyence is a globally operating company with an extensive sales and service network. The company is present in many countries, including Germany, Austria, and Switzerland. Keyence strives to provide its customers with fast and efficient service and works closely with them to meet their requirements. Overall, the Keyence Corporation is an innovative company that offers a wide range of products and solutions for industrial automation. With its high quality and reliability, Keyence has become an important partner for many companies in various industries. Keyence is one of the most popular companies on Eulerpool.com.

The fair value of a stock provides insights into whether the stock is currently undervalued or overvalued. It is calculated based on profit, revenue, or dividends and offers a comprehensive perspective of the stock’s intrinsic value.

Income-Based Fair Value

This is calculated by multiplying the earnings per share by the average P/E ratio of the selected past years for smoothing. If the fair value is higher than the current market price, it suggests that the stock is undervalued.

Example 2022

Fair Value Profit 2022 = Earnings per Share 2022 / Average P/E Ratio 2019 - 2021 (3 Years Smoothing)

Revenue-Based Fair Value

It is derived by multiplying the revenue per share by the average price-to-sales ratio of the selected past years for smoothing. An undervalued stock is identified if the fair value exceeds the ongoing market price.

Example 2022

Fair Value Revenue 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 / Average PSR 2019 - 2021 (3 Years Smoothing)

Dividend-Based Fair Value

This value is determined by dividing the dividend per share by the average dividend yield of the selected past years for smoothing. A higher fair value than the market price indicates an undervalued stock.

Example 2022

Fair Value Dividend 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 * Average Dividend Yield 2019 - 2021 (3 Years Smoothing)

Who are the main competitors of Keyence in the market?

Keyence Corp faces competition from various companies in the market. Some of its main competitors include Omron Corporation, Panasonic Corporation, Rockwell Automation Inc., and Siemens AG. These companies compete with Keyence Corp in the areas of industrial automation, process control systems, sensors, and other related technologies.
